Transportation Security Officer Job Overview
Thank you for considering employment with TSA. As a Transportation Security Officer (TSO), you'll play a vital role in supporting the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) mission.
Local Airport Details
- Location: Cold Bay Airport, Cold Bay, AK
- Schedule: 8 hours per day, 2 days per week
- Peak Times: Wednesday and Saturday, 9 a.m. – 6 p.m.
- Environment: Screening operations inside the terminal; may not be temperature controlled.
Work Schedules
TSO work schedules depend on operational needs, including non-traditional shifts, weekends, and holidays.
Note: Limited flexibility is offered for personal commitments. Specific shifts are assigned post-training and may change based on operational demands. TSA employees are considered emergency personnel and must report during inclement weather.
Part-time Opportunities
We are assessing candidates for part-time positions:
- Hours: 16 hrs. per week (two workdays, eight hours each).
Sign-On Bonus
Currently, there is no sign-on bonus available at this location.
Commuter Details
- Parking: Free onsite parking for TSA employees.
- Public Transport: Not available.
- Transportation Subsidies: Not offered.

Promotional Potential
Under the career ladder system for TSOs, new officers can achieve up to a 67% increase from the starting base salary over 5 years.
Travel and Training Requirements
Employment is contingent upon successful completion of classroom and on-the-job training, which may require up to six weeks of full-time travel away from your airport of record. Compensable hours and travel expenses will be reimbursed.
Dress Code
TSO uniforms are provided, with restrictions on personal grooming and accessories while in uniform.
